Wednesday just wasn't the day for Oceanside's offense. They lost 10-0 to the Carlsbad Lancers on Wednesday. If the Pirates were looking for revenge after losing 1-0 to the Lancers when the teams met back in June of 2021, then they'll just have to keep looking.
Oceanside sa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Seaven Fuimaono, who went 2-for-3 with one double.
Oceanside has also been struggling recently as they've lost three of their last four matchups. That's put a noticeable dent in their 4-9 record this season. Carlsbad's first victory this season bumped their record up to 1-7.
